COVID-19 Update

The Columbia County Department of Health has released its numbers for today. Since yesterday, there have been 24 new cases of COVID-19. The number of active cases being reported today is 21 more than yesterday, from which it can be inferred that, since yesterday, three county residents have recovered from the virus. There is one more county resident in mandatory quarantine today than yesterday. The number hospitalized with the virus is the same as yesterday, but today no one is in the ICU. There has not been another death from COVID-19 reported by the CCDOH since yesterday. 

The New York Forward dashboard is reporting a positivity rate for Columbia County yesterday of 6.3 percent and a seven-day average of 2.8 percent. By comparison, the daily positivity rate for the Capital Region is 3.2 percent and the seven-day average is 4.5 percent.

A year ago today, the CCDOH reported 1 new case of COVID-19. The total number of cases was 547, and the number of active cases was 3. There were 15 county residents in mandatory quarantine, and no one was hospitalized or in the ICU. The total number of deaths attributed to COVID-19 at this time last year was 37.
